SUMMARY:Ron Manning\, Healthcare in Suffolk County
DESCRIPTION:Members and friendsThis morning’s speaker was Ron Manning\, Asst. Director of Patient Services\, Suffolk County Heath Dept. I learned from Ron’s presentation of a system that I was hardly aware existed. \nThere are 11 Suffolk County Health Centers. These centers are serving those communities where there is a serious need. However they are open top all who should apply. They have a patient list of 60\,000 people. The patients are charged on a sliding scale and about 40% of the patients are not charged at all. Some of the patients do have insurance and use these facilities because they are convenient\, or for other personal reasons. \nThis system reminded me of the US Public Health facilities that existed in the city of New York when I was a child. The function of a facility such as this goes far beyond the care of those who need the services. It addresses the need to control communicable diseases by keeping the less fortunate healthy. In a sense\, whether we need these services ourselves or not\, we in the general population are among the beneficiaries \nMr. manning answered many questions about how the funding is done\, as well as what special services are made available to the population that unit serves. SUMMARY:Charles Wang- CA founder "The Lighthouse"
DESCRIPTION:Members and friendsOur speaker this morning had a packed house. LIMBA board member\, and former Suffolk County Executive Robert Gaffney Introduced the speaker. \nThe topic involved one of the most ambitious plans conceived in recent times. Charles Wang\, who we identify as the founder of Computer Associates\, is continuing to think big with his concept of the Lighthouse Development. This project has\, in the words of famed Chicago architect Daniel Burnham\, has “the power stir men’s blood.” \nThe Lighthouse Development encompasses a myriad of mixed uses\, including retail\, bistro’s and restaurants\, cultural venues\, health and fitness facilities\, sports arenas\, parks\, and commons that will be attractive to families and pedestrians. While it is the central structure\, known as The Lighthouse\, that claims the name to this vision\, it is all the other elements that combine to create a proud venue. \nThe graphics for this endeavor are breathtaking. While watching the animation\, which was very professionally done\, I could sense myself breathing deeply as I watched the concept unfold on the screen. The graphics lasted about 8 minutes and then Charles spoke to the audience in his very communicative style that he is famous for. After that portion he asked the audience for questions\, which they were eager to give him. \nUsually the Q&A is the most interesting part of the program\, and the axiom proved true again. Mr. Wang has an easy and fluid style. He is succinct\, pithy\, informative and charming. When asked about the best case scenario for starting\, the answer was three years. There was a question about legislative support and sadly\, political people are not eager to think as innovators. There were questions about transportation links\, parking\, and power generation needs.
